Kannon Shanmugam Argues Hawaii Public-Lands Case Before Supreme Court
April 2009

On February 25, 2009, Williams & Connolly LLP partner Kannon Shanmugam presented oral argument to the United States Supreme Court on behalf of the respondents in Hawaii v. Office of Hawaiian Affairs, No. 07-1372, which concerned the validity of a state-court injunction barring the State of Hawaii from selling 1.2 million acres of public lands held in trust for Native Hawaiians. On March 31, 2009, the Supreme Court issued its decision, holding that it had jurisdiction to review the decision below but agreeing with the respondents that the case should be remanded to the Hawaii Supreme Court for further proceedings.
